Article/Chapter Title: Legal, ethical and due process issues
Abstract: Mental health practitioners and clinical investigators face special ethical challenges when working with older adults with intellectual and developmental disabilities (IDD). This chapter discussed these challenges in relation to treatment recommendations for psychopharmacological interventions. The limited cognitive and emotional characteristics of ageing persons with IDD and their relative lack of legal status and social power make them particularly vulnerable to misuse of these drugs and to their corresponding risks. © Springer Nature Switzerland AG 2021.
